ARK: Survival Evolved Coming to Switch This Fall

ARK: Survival Evolved Coming to Switch This Fall - News

by William D'Angelo , posted on 21 March 2018 / 3,552 Views

Studio Wildcard announced at the Game Developers Conference today in a panel that the dinosaur survival game Ark: Survival Evolved is getting a port on the Nintendo Switch. It will release this fall. 


Just last week it was announced the game would be getting a release on iOS and Android.
